The Katsina State Police Command, yesterday, said it successfully neutralised three suspected kidnappers during a shootout at the Kankara-Dutsinma federal highway.

The command said the incident occurred on December 10. It said there was an exchange of gunfire, which led to a vigilante sustaining gunshot injury. In a statement, spokesperson for the command, ASP Abubakar Aliyu, said: “On December 10, 2023, at about 04:30 hours, there was credible information that some suspected armed robbers and kidnappers, wielding dangerous weapons such as AK-47 rifles, blocked the Dutsinma-Kankara highway in an attempt to kidnap unsuspecting members of the public. Upon receipt of the report, the Area Commander, Dutsinma, mobilised a joint team of police operatives and vigilantes and moved to the scene.

“Upon reaching the scene, the suspected kidnappers opened fire on the operatives. The officers valiantly returned fire and succeeded in neutralising three members of the gang. Also, one Masa’udu Sani, a vigilante, sustained a gunshot wound to his right hand.”

He disclosed that the injured operative is currently responding to treatment while efforts are underway to arrest other fleeing suspects, and that investigation is in process.

“While praising the operatives’ professionalism, synergy, and bravery, the Commissioner of Police, Katsina State Command, Aliyu Musa, urged the officers to sustain the tempo and called on citizens of the state to provide the command and other security agencies with information on criminal activities, so that swift action could be taken,” Aliyu added.
